The analysis of a comparison of the latitudinal and diurnal temperature variations in Earth's upper atmosphere obtained using the satellite UARS measurements and the model of neutral atmosphere MSIS-86 (Mass-Spectrometer-Incoherent-Scatter) calculations has been carried out. The model has combined the mass-spectrometer data of 17 satellites and incoherent scatter data of 5 ground-based stations. The device WINDII, installed in satellite UARS, measured the temperature from photo-chemical airglow of emission lines in height range 85-300 km. The latitudinal and diurnal temperature variations ware considered for the heights 90-110 km, 150 km, 200 km and 250 km. As a result of comparison it was found a good agreement between satellite measurements and model computations. The conclusion about the MSIS-86 model to be applicable for investigation of latitudinal, longitudinal, diurnal and seasonal variations of the temperature in Earth's upper atmosphere has been done.
